A Look Back at Barbara Carrera's Career
Born in Nicaragua, Barbara Carrera began her career as a model before transitioning to acting. Her striking looks and undeniable charisma quickly propelled her to fame. Some of her notable roles include:
- "The Master Gunfighter" (1975): This marked her first significant role in Hollywood.
- "Embryo" (1976): A science fiction thriller showcasing her versatility.
- "Centennial" (1978): A popular TV miniseries where she played Clay Basket.
- "Condorman" (1981): A Disney adventure film.
- "Never Say Never Again" (1983): As Fatima Blush, she starred alongside Sean Connery's James Bond, cementing her status as a Bond girl.
Carrera continued to act throughout the 1980s and 90s, appearing in various films and television shows. She also ventured into painting, showcasing her artwork in galleries.
What is Barbara Carrera Doing Now?
In recent years, Barbara Carrera has maintained a relatively private life. While she hasn't completely retired from the public eye, she has significantly scaled back her acting career. Here’s what we know about her current activities:
Art and Painting
Carrera has dedicated much of her time to her passion for art. She is an accomplished painter, and her works have been exhibited in galleries around the world. Her art often reflects her vibrant personality and diverse cultural background. You can find examples of her work and updates on her artistic endeavors through various online art platforms and galleries.
Philanthropy
Barbara Carrera has also been involved in philanthropic efforts, supporting causes related to children's welfare and environmental conservation. While she keeps a low profile, her dedication to these causes remains a significant part of her life.
Occasional Appearances
While she primarily focuses on her art, Carrera occasionally makes appearances at film festivals and industry events. These appearances allow her to reconnect with fans and colleagues, keeping her connected to her Hollywood past.
